Limitations of Big Five Research and Developmental Factors

This chapter explores the limitations of the big five research in accounting for contextual and developmental factors. It discusses the derivation of introversion from lexical terms, experiments on inhibited and uninhibited behavior in children, and the concept of differential susceptibility in developmental psychology and adult personality. The chapter also mentions controversial opinions on interventions for highly sensitive children.
